Smyth Street man gunned down in early morning execution

Police investigators have arrested one man following the early Saturday morning gunning down of Smyth Street, Charlestown resident, Oriley Small.

The incident reportedly took place just after 3:30 this morning.  According to reports he was inside his yard when a lone gunman dressed in a hooded tee-shirt shot him multiple times about the body.

Family members said he was out earlier in the night at a nightspot and had just returned home when he was attacked and executed. Moments before he was shot, a relative said they heard him shouting “hey boy move from deh”.

Police A’ Division Commander, Asst. Commissioner Clifton Hicken confirmed to News Source that one man has been taken in to custody “based on information” following the shooting.

He said investigators are on the ground continuing their probe.   Family members and neighbours are expected to be questioned this morning.
